What are the characteristics of the trailer extension cable?

A trailer extension cable is a type of electrical cable used to connect a trailer to a vehicle's electrical system. The main characteristics of a trailer extension cable include:
Length: Trailer extension cables come in different lengths, typically ranging from 4 feet to 25 feet or more. The length of the cable needed will depend on the distance between the trailer and the vehicle's electrical system.
Connectors: Trailer extension cables usually have two connectors, one for the trailer and one for the vehicle. The connectors are usually designed to match the wiring of the vehicle and trailer, with the most common types being 4-pin, 5-pin, 6-pin, and 7-pin connectors.
Durability: Trailer extension cables are designed to withstand the rigors of outdoor use and frequent connection and disconnection. They are typically made with heavy-duty insulation, rugged connectors, and a weather-resistant jacket to protect the cable from water, dirt, and other elements.
Gauge: The gauge of a trailer extension cable refers to the thickness of the wires inside the cable. The gauge will affect the maximum amount of current that can flow through the cable without overheating. Thicker gauge cables can handle more current, but they may also be heavier and more difficult to handle.
Compatibility: Trailer extension cables are designed to be compatible with a wide range of trailers and vehicles, but it is important to ensure that the cable matches the wiring of both the vehicle and the trailer to avoid electrical issues and potential safety hazards.
